Transaction 382521ba624a13b4f6c5a9e2c4184cd54f1e1175c69c1fd811916e71fe8a366d

2 Input
2 Outputs
  • 382521ba624a13b4f6c5a9e2c4184cd54f1e1175c69c1fd811916e71fe8a366d:0
  • value  20912
    address  34h7RjYFB8iPnPFQtiwyBTqyf6s4SrqQLE
  • 382521ba624a13b4f6c5a9e2c4184cd54f1e1175c69c1fd811916e71fe8a366d:1
  • value  179994
    address  39J7NGNRM9Nn5hmLqTEEJchnR9CYpT3kb3